Roxy Posted March 30, 2008 Share Posted March 30, 2008 Alaska Salmon Bake with Pecan Crunch Coating: Ingredients: 3 T. honey-dijon mustard or spicy brown mustard 3 T. butter, melted 5 tsp.s honey 1/2 cup Panko bread crumbs 1/2 cup finely chopped pecans 3 tsp.s fresly chopped parsley 6-(4 oz) salmon fillets Cajun Spice & Blackening Rub-Albertson's carries it 6 lemon wedges Directions: 1. Preheat the oven to 400 F. In a small bowl, mix together the mustard, butter, and honey. In another bowl, mix together the bread crumbs, pecans and parsley. 2. Let the butter mixture rest for 15 minutes to allow to thicken so it coats the salmon nicely. 3. Season each salmon fillet with Cajun Spice & Blackening Rub. Place on a lightly greased baking sheet. Brush with mustard-honey mixture. Cover the top of each fillet with bread mixture and press in so it won't fall off when serving. 4. Bake for 20 minutes for 6 normal sized fillets or until fish flakes easily with a fork. **While fish is baking..heat olive oil or butter in a skillet and saute mushrooms, onions and garlic together till tender. Serve this on top of the salmon. Garnish with lemon wedges. I squeeze the lemon juice on the fish. ****I will post the chef recipe tomorrow..want to make it first. Quote Link to comment
